About This Home

12 Month Lease, $5,395 deposit, Available Now

Welcome to this charming 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om home with 1,449 sq ft of living space, offered fully furnished and thoughtfully maintained. The upgraded kitchen shines with modern stainless steel appliances, while functionality takes center stage with a dedicated laundry room featuring a brand-new washer and dryer. A refrigerator is also included in the lease for added convenience. The home is enhanced with new A/C, providing year-round comfort. Security and peace of mind are top priorities, with ADT security, Ring cameras, and a fully fenced backyard featuring block wall fencing and alley access. The gardener service is included in the lease, ensuring the grounds stay pristine with minimal effort. Outdoors, the tranquil yard is lined with mature fruit and shade trees, including avocado, olive, and lemon trees offering both privacy and natural beauty. A spacious cement patio makes this backyard an entertainer's dream. This property is available furnished or unfurnished, depending on your needs. Truly turn-key, this West Hills residence offers comfort, style, and security all in one. MLS# GD25230773

City - Los Angeles

There are numerous nicknames for Los Angeles, just as there are various vibes within this sprawling city. Between rugged mountains and sandy shorelines, a laid-back surf culture and a high-powered commercial district, and food trucks and some of the world’s top-rated restaurants, Los Angeles features diversity in every aspect possible. Somehow, all the pieces of this city fit together seamlessly, making Los Angeles the unique destination we know and love. From Rodeo Drive and Beverly Hills to Hollywood and Chinatown, there is the perfect neighborhood for everyone in Los Angeles.

From celebrity sightings to unbeatable shopping destinations, Los Angeles is hard to beat. Enjoy a hike in the Santa Monica Mountains, Griffith Park, or Topanga State Park, enjoy the famous entertainment at Universal Studios Hollywood, see the stars along the legendary Hollywood Walk of Fame, or stop into the Los Angeles County Museum of Art.
